Output 51d96c5e606474233cf620257bc4e643c52a58bff73e2f78a5b462de5ffbfeff:5

value
47418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f4113cdb21dbeae95badf74091ffad339689d8 OP_EQUAL
address
3PPCT6whTUL86KRjsJsND4FQWVyW2t8UJe
transaction
51d96c5e606474233cf620257bc4e643c52a58bff73e2f78a5b462de5ffbfeff
spent
true